DEPARTMENT: Transportation & Capital Improvements


DEPARTMENT HEAD: Mike Frisbie, P.E.


COUNCIL DISTRICTS IMPACTED: Council District 1


SUBJECT:

Real Estate Disposition: Closure of an unimproved alley Public Right of Way located between East Jones Avenue and 10th Street.

SUMMARY:

A resolution supporting the closure, vacation and abandonment of an unimproved 0.200 acre alley located between East Jones Avenue and 10th Street, in Council District 1, as requested by Liberty Properties, for a fee of $194,987.00.


BACKGROUND INFORMATION:

Liberty Properties, Petitioner, is requesting the closure, vacation and abandonment of an unimproved alley Public Right of Way located in NCB 458 between East Jones Avenue and 10th Street as shown on attached Exhibit A. The Petitioner is the sole abutting property owner and if the closure is approved, they would like to re-plat and.re-develop the property for the construction of a new multi-family and mixed use development.

This action is consistent with City Code and Ordinances, which require City Council approval for the sale or disposition of City-owned or controlled real property.


ALTERNATIVES:

Planning Commission could choose not to approve this request; however, if not approved, the right of way will remain underutilized.
